Description
The Bell & Gossett 110122 (790-36) is a high-performance ASME-certified safety relief valve designed to protect fired and unfired hot water vessels from overpressure. Built with a bronze body and EPDM diaphragm-assisted design, it ensures reliable performance and superior durability.
Engineered in compliance with Section IV of the ASME Boiler & Pressure Vessel Code, and certified by the National Board of Boiler and Pressure Vessel Inspectors, this valve delivers enhanced safety and peace of mind for heating system operators.
Unlike conventional pop-type valves, the diaphragm design provides a significantly larger effective operating area—about 5 times greater—resulting in better responsiveness and resistance to fouling. A unique fail-safe disc maintains pressure relief functionality even in the event of diaphragm rupture.
